Metcalf & Eddy, Inc. performed a one-season pilot study at a 5 MGD conventional treatment plant located in Rockville, Connecticut. The purpose of the pilot study was to determine if the performance of the existing facility could be improved by using an advanced treatment process. The existing treatment plant consists of two Perifilter-treatment units with GAC filtration; the pilot scale testing utilized the Superpulsator(r) and Type U Superpulsator(r) units in combination with single media GAC and sand filtration. Pre-ozone and/or intermediate ozone were added to the advanced process to evaluate its effect on organic and disinfection byproduct precursor removal. This paper compares the performance of the existing facility and the pilot process for removal of TOC, total trihalomethanes and haloacetic acids in the distribution system. The benefits of utilizing advanced treatment to treat a surface water supply and the capability of the pilot scale and existing processes to meet the Disinfection By-Product Rule are discussed.
